Reply-To: support at pfsense dot com User-Agent: Thunderbird 1.5.0.4 (X11/20060615) Hi group, just writting this short note to let you know how Cortex Systems - "your soekris provider" operate. I did a bank transfer for a soekris net4801-60 (256MB RAM) and other elements. When it arrived the hardware only recognizes 128MB of RAM. I got in touch with the support team and a tecnical & sales consultant (i will avoid personal references) told the that i should pay the expenses of send back the box to Denmark. I told him/her that when i paid i used money in good standing and i wait to have exactly the same behavior with the product i'm buying. The answer was "That's the way it works when you buy via the internet, this is standard practice." I told him/her that was funny that the standard practice were make a client pay twice for a product/service. So friends, think twice if you're going to buy in Cortex Systems your soekris hardware for Firewall/Router/Misc. because if you have a problem you will have to pay for a sevice bad offered.
